Etheridge(i)
1 And after the tumult had stilled, Paulos called the disciples and consoled them and kissed them, and going forth went unto Makedunia.
2 And when he had itinerated those regions, and had consoled them with many words, he came into the country of Hales,[Quasi dicat, HELLAS, Greece.]
3 and was there three months. But the Jihudoyee wrought treachery against him, when he was about to go into Syria, and had thought to return into Makedunia.
4 And (there) went forth with him into Asia Supatros who was from Berula, the city; and Aristarkos and Sakundos, who (were) from Thessalonika; and Gaios, who was from Derbe the city; and Timotheos, who was from Lystra; and from Asia, Tukikos and Trophimos.
5 These went before us, and waited for us in Troas.
6 But we went forth from Philipos, a city of the Makedunoyee, after the days of the Phatiree, and voyaged by sea and came to Troas in five days, and there were we seven days.
